![]() Knight of the Outer VoidType: Character Faction: Silver Twilight Cost: 3 Skill: 3 Icons: (C)(C)(A) Game Text: Lodge. Willpower. Forced Response: During your refresh phase, choose and return a Silver Twilight character you control to it's owner's hand. Set: TOotST Number: 23 Illustrator: A. M. Sartor |

I have overlooked this card thus far, but as Runix mentioned, it could be a strong card in the right deck. It has a good set of icons to go with it's willpower.
Now that Initiate of Huang Hun is unrestricted, I have been using him as an eventual way to refresh BRB by bouncing him using Initiate, then returning Initiate with Knight. Or you can just return BRB to your hand with him. Works great with Jeffrey too. He's a x2 in my modern ST decks.
I only recently began to branch out in other factions than MU/Shub (we had our card pool split in our gaming group), but this appeared to be a great toolbox card. There are more than a few obvious uses (most of which are already named, I guess), and I wouldn't be surprised if there are some hidden combo gems to be found in the growing ST card pool. I really like it. 2-off seems to be a good number, too.
This is a great way to reset August Lindquist as well, which is harder due to his Willpower.
The only thing worrying me is that it's a _Forced_ Response. If you ever end up in a situation where you don't want to bounce any of your characters, you're hosed. Given that in most of my recent games I've been lucky to keep one or two characters in play at most, I'd never play this guy.
Well, you can always target himself. But I agree, in a heavy removal environment there is no place for a guy like this.
